The postcode RH13 9AE is located in Horsham, in the county of West Sussex. It was introduced in May 2013 and is an active postcode. RH13 9AE is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

RH13 9AE is one of the least de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 8.2 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of RH13 9AE as Suburbanites > Suburban achievers > Comfortable suburbia.

The closest road name to RH13 9AE is Martindales which is centered 27 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Warnham Gate and is 116 m away. The closest railway station is Christs Hospital Rail Station, 1.89 km away.

The closest primary school to RH13 9AE (for ages 11 and under) is Castlewood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on September 27, 2017.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Christ's Hospital.

The local pub for residents of RH13 9AE is Hen And Chicken and is 465 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as AwaitingInspection on August 4, 2021. The nearest takeaway food is available from Capital Fish & Chips and Chinese and is 1.65 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on February 18, 2020.

Residents reported an average download speed of 27 Mbps and an average upload speed of 6.1 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 41.5%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.3 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for RH13 9AE is covered by the Sussex police force association and West Sussex is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
